    "No weapons."

    "Agreed." Shao Qi put down his Yong'an and glanced at Zhou You's waist and chest, saying, "You should remove your hidden weapons as well."

    Dumping all his concealed weapons aside, Zhou You stretched and quipped, "I almost forgot about them earlier. Maybe with another try, I could win."

    "Confidence is good. But only a fight will tell," retorted Shao Qi.

    "Bring it on." The two figures darted towards each other in a blur, fists met fists, palms collided with palms. The surging internal energy enveloped them, their movements so swift that only afterimages were visible.

    In just a few minutes, despite countless exchanges, it was clear that Shao Qi was on the offense and Zhou You on defense. It wasn't that Zhou You couldn't overcome Shao Qi, but rather, he lacked Shao Qi's repertoire and proficiency in techniques.

    Minutes into their spar, Shao Qi suddenly found himself at a disadvantage. To his astonishment, Zhou You was mimicking the moves he had just used.

    Truly a martial prodigy!

    Shao Qi immediately transitioned into a new palm technique. His palms acted as blades. As the first strike hurtled towards Zhou You, he almost thought Shao Qi was cheating with a weapon.

    "Impressive! What's this palm technique called?"

    "It's something I created myself. I haven't named it yet."

    "Given that your palm strikes feel like blade winds, why not call it 'Palm Blade'?" It was a simple name. Shao Qi nodded in agreement, "Sounds good. I'll document it in a few days."

    Zhou You quickly switched to a Tai Chi style, one he had learned while observing Zhang Huaixun's duel. His rendition seemed even more fluid and supple, exemplifying the principle of yielding to overcome force.

    "Even Master Qingfeng would admit defeat to this level of Tai Chi."

    "Please don't spread that around. I wouldn't want people saying I've stolen from the Wudang martial arts."

    "That old man might think I stole their secret manuals on your behalf."

    In truth, once one has a deep understanding of martial arts, extrapolating from a few demonstrations isn't rare. What's crucial is mastering the concept of "Qi". For an expert like Zhou You, the results are always amplified, no matter which martial art is used.

    A gust from his own strike backfired on Shao Qi, propelling him against a test wall. A gentle punch landed near him, and a beeping sound filled his ears.

    "Congratulations, Marshal. Punch strength: 584,631. This breaks the previous record. Would you like to save this result?"

    Shao Qi jumped down from the wall, looking up at the testing panel. After pressing a few buttons, a series of records from the past three years appeared, ranging from two hundred thousand to five hundred fifty thousand. But now, Zhou You had shattered the previous records.

    However, the record of five hundred fifty thousand was set when he had just returned. If he used all his strength now, it would probably match Zhou You's, but there was no certainty that Zhou You had gone all out.

    "I always thought I'd surpass you in terms of power."

    "Technically, you did. The punch earlier actually incorporated some of your own force and redirected it back at you. My own punch strength is probably around five hundred thousand."

    "Want to give it a shot?" Neither wanted to continue fighting; any further and both might end up injured.

    "Sure." Zhou You then asked, "Can I take a running start?"

    "Of course, hit it however you want."

    Zhou You glanced at his fist, considering how to optimize his punch.

    With a layer of internal energy enveloping his fist, he punched the testing wall with all his might.

    A resounding "Bang!" echoed, sounding as if a truck had crashed into the wall. The display lit up with a number just above five hundred ten thousand, slightly less than before.

    "Try with a weapon," Shao Qi suggested.

    Zhou You gripped a curved blade, feeling it wasn't quite right. Such a blade relied on finesse, not brute force.

    Shao Qi offered his own blade, "Use this one."

    Switching to the Yong An blade and holding it tightly, Zhou You could almost feel the immense power Shao Qi wielded when using this weapon.

    A powerful blade wind left a deep mark on the testing wall. Similar marks, of varying depths, were scattered across the wall.

    The final reading settled at five hundred seventy thousand, just a bit short of the earlier record.

    "Come on, let's test something else." Shao Qi had him use every measuring instrument in his training room and even drew a tube of blood, claiming it could measure the concentration of spiritual energy.

    It's said that those with a higher concentration of spiritual energy have better physical conditions, and martial artists typically have values several times that of ordinary people.

    "Speed really is your forte. I can't keep up even if I tried," Shao Qi remarked, looking at the updated records.

    "Speed is also linked to explosive power. Your explosive power surpasses mine, and our speeds are not much different."

    "By the way, based on the Martial Arts Association's ranking, what level are we?"

    Zhou You had a hunch, but he was still surprised when Shao Qi mentioned "Senior Martial Commander."

    A Martial Commander is already the highest known realm. Had they already reached the senior level?

    "Based on my assessment, you're probably at your peak now. Just a little breakthrough and you might step into the Martial God realm. Currently, no one knows what that realm is like, not even a basic hypothetical."

    "Then how can one determine if they've reached the Martial God realm?"

    "I'm not certain. Perhaps some will understand when they reach that point. Those bound by numerical limits can't be considered gods. In simpler terms, the title 'High-Level Martial Marshal' is quite broad. Until one becomes a god, they remain at this rank."

    "That's one way to put it. But who can truly know if they've achieved such a state?" Zhou You gazed down at his hand, feeling his immense power, yet he sensed that he was still far from the elusive realm Shao Qi spoke of.
